The housing market in Norden, ND is much more affordable than the national average. The median value of a house in Norden, ND is $88,000 whereas the US median value is $338,100. This past year saw a 8.27% appreciation rate on housing across the US while Norden, ND experienced an even greater appreciation rate of 9.41%. The median home cost in Norden is $88,000.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 51.1%. Home Appreciation in Norden is up 10.5%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Norden real estate is 48 years old
